Who is Alex Prieto?

Alejandro Antonio "Alex" Prieto [pre-AY-to] is a Major League Baseball second baseman and right-handed batter who is currently a member of the Edmonton Capitals of the North American League. He played parts of two seasons in the majors, 2003 and 2004, for the Minnesota Twins. In those seasons, Prieto batted .209 with one home run and four RBI in 24 games.

Prieto played for the Boston Red Sox AAA-affiliate, the Pawtucket Red Sox in 2007. In 2008, he played for the Bridgeport Bluefish in the Atlantic League. In 2009, he played for the Long Island Ducks of the Atlantic League.
